Understanding Rural Construction Demand in Sumatra
Before choosing any batching plant, investors must first understand the local construction reality. This is especially important in rural Sumatra.
Compared with Jakarta or Surabaya, rural projects follow a different rhythm. Projects are smaller. Schedules are flexible. Budgets are tight. At the same time, consistency and reliability still matter.
Because of this, demand usually comes from:
Low-Rise Housing and Village Infrastructure
Most rural projects focus on one- to three-story houses, schools, clinics, drainage systems, and village roads. These projects rarely need massive daily output. Instead, they need stable supply over weeks or months.
In this scenario, a 35 m³/h small concrete plant fits naturally. It can support daily pours without overproduction. It also avoids idle capacity, which often hurts cash flow.

Why 35 m³/h Capacity Makes Sense for New Investors
Once you understand demand, the next step is matching it with plant output. This is where the 35 m³/h batching plant shows its strength.
Compared with larger plants, this capacity feels balanced. It avoids unnecessary complexity. It also lowers the entry barrier.
Balanced Output for Daily Construction Needs
A 35 m³/h plant can typically produce 200–280 m³ of concrete per day under normal working hours. This volume matches rural project schedules well.
For example, small road paving may need 120–180 m³ per day. Housing clusters may consume even less. Therefore, investors can supply multiple sites without pressure.
At the same time, the plant still leaves room for peak demand. This flexibility matters during dry seasons when construction speeds up.

Practical Advantages in Rural Sumatra Conditions
Beyond capacity, site conditions in Sumatra strongly influence equipment choice. This is where smaller batching plants gain another advantage.
Rural areas often present logistical challenges. Land is available, but infrastructure is limited. Power supply may be unstable. Transport distances are long.
Easier Installation and Site Adaptability
A 35 m³/h mini mix plant for sale usually requires less foundation work. It fits well on compact sites. Transport and installation take less time.
Because of this, investors can start production faster. Early operation means earlier revenue. This matters a lot for new entrants.
Lower Operating Complexity for Local Teams
In rural Sumatra, skilled operators are not always easy to find. Simpler systems reduce training pressure.
This type of plant often uses straightforward control systems. Maintenance routines stay manageable. Spare parts remain affordable.
As a result, daily operation feels less stressful. Investors can focus more on sales and project coordination.
